Spate of resignations prevents Merced County Housing Authority from meeting

Four Merced County Housing Authority commissioners have resigned, leaving the board unable to hold meetings once again because of a lack of participation.

Business leaders draft 'letter of nonconfidence' in Merced County Board of Supervisors

Local business leaders are taking aim at the Merced County Board of Supervisors. In a draft letter obtained by the Sun-Star, several chamber of commerce presidents are set to sign a "letter of non-confidence" in the county's economic development programs, permitting processes and planning programs.

Collin County gets 6,500 doses of H1N1 vaccine, but officials had requested 42,550

The Collin County health department has received 6,500 doses of the swine flu vaccine from the state this week and is distributing them to private clinics and hospitals. The shipment is the county's first from the state since it received 500 doses last month. Officials have been upset that the state didn't send more doses of H1N1 vaccine sooner. Volusia County bans outdoor burning

Beginning Saturday, there is a ban on outdoor burning for unincorporated Volusia County as well as the cities of Oak Hill, Lake Helen and Pierson.

Only Volusia bans burning as drought conditions worsen

Volusia is apparently the first county in the state to enact a ban on outdoor burning as drought conditions throughout the peninsula of Florida begin to worsen.
